Here are your results for AEW Collision May 8, 2025:
- "Timeless" Toni Storm started off the show with a promo with her usual innuendo, suggesting she'll defend her AEW Women's World Championship next week at Beach Break, either during Dynamite or Collision.
- Paragon (Adam Cole, Kyle O'Reilly, and Roderick Strong) were interviewed about losing to FTR. Grizzled Young Veterans interrupted, calling them soft. Any time they're ready for a fight, they want to face them.
- Ricochet defeated Angelico by pinfall. After the match, Ricochet cut a promo ragging on the fans and the Detroit Lions. He then noticed Zach Gowen in the front row, made fun of his missing leg, took out some security and cut the hair of one of them. Gowen got into the ring to try to stop him. Ricochet kicked his prosthetic leg and hit a Spirit Gun on him. Ricochet then took the prosthetic off Gowen and walked away with it.
- The Don Callis Family (Kyle Fletcher, Lance Archer, Trent Beretta and Rocky Romero) defeated The Outrunners (Turbo Floyd & Truth Magnum), Bandido, and AR Fox in an eight-man tag team match by pinfall.
- A pre-taped promo aired with Jon Moxley talking about how excited he is to face Samoa Joe inside a steel cage for the AEW World Championship Wednesday night on AEW Dynamite Beach Break.
- Anthony Bowens defeated Lee Johnson by pinfall.
- The Gates of Agony called out The Learning Tree. Bishop Kaun and Toa Liona fought with Big Bill and Bryan Keith, going through tables until everyone was down and officials came out to check on everyone.
- A video package was dedicated to Anna Jay vs. Megan Bayne.
- Kris Statlander defeated Willow Nightingale by pinfall due in part by Marina Shafir interfering, but not with Statlander being aware of it.
- Skye Blue will be returning at Beach Break.
- The Don Callis Family's Josh Alexander and Konosuke Takeshita defeated Dark Order's Alex Reynolds and Evil Uno by pinfall.
- "Speedball" Mike Bailey defeated Dralistico by pinfall. RUSH came out after the match, but backed down before entering the ring.
- Ric Flair will be part of a tribute to Steve "Mongo" McMichael next week on Collision.
- Daniel Garcia vs. Dax Harwood ended in a no-contest after interference from "Daddy Magic" Matt Menard, Nigel McGuinness, and of course, Cash Wheeler.
